DescriptionCVE.org

Vulnerability in the Oracle Supply Chain Globalization product of Oracle E-Business Suite (component: Copy Inventory Organization).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.3-12.2.15.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Supply Chain Globalization.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ized update, insert or delete access to some of Oracle Supply Chain Globalization accessible data as well as unauthorized read access to a subset of Oracle Supply Chain Globalization accessible data and unauthorized ability to cause a partial denial of service (partial DOS) of Oracle Supply Chain Globalization.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 6.3 (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L).

AnalysisAI

Partial data compromise and denial of service in Oracle Supply Chain Globalization (Oracle E-Business Suite) allows low-privileged authenticated attackers over HTTP to perform unauthorized read, write, and partial availability impacts against the Copy Inventory Organization component. Affected versions span 12.2.3 through 12.2.15, covering a broad range of the E-Business Suite 12.2 release train. No public exploit code and no CISA KEV listing have been identified at time of analysis, placing this in the category of a credible but not actively weaponized medium-severity vulnerability.

Technical ContextAI

Oracle E-Business Suite (EBS) is a comprehensive enterprise resource planning platform. The Supply Chain Globalization module within EBS manages cross-border inventory and logistics operations, and the Copy Inventory Organization component specifically handles duplication of inventory org structures. The flaw resides in the HTTP-accessible interface of this component, permitting low-privileged users to interact with it in unintended ways. The CWE classification was not provided by the vendor, so the precise root cause class - whether improper authorization, insufficient access control, or input validation failure - cannot be confirmed from available data. The CVSS vector (A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L) indicates a straightforward, low-complexity network attack requiring only a basic authenticated session, with all impacts constrained to low severity and no scope change.

RemediationAI

Apply the Oracle Critical Patch Update (CPU) for July 2026, available at https://www.oracle.com/security-alerts/cpujul2026.html, which addresses this vulnerability in Oracle E-Business Suite. The exact patched version is not independently specified in the available data beyond the CPU reference - organizations should consult the July 2026 CPU documentation for precise patch identifiers and installation instructions. As a compensating control prior to patching, administrators may consider restricting network access to the Copy Inventory Organization component of Supply Chain Globalization to only those user roles that legitimately require it, reducing exposure to low-privileged internal accounts. Note that tightening role-based access controls within EBS may require testing to avoid disrupting legitimate supply chain workflows.
